    Pesto Chicken Tortellini and Veggies

    Pesto Chicken Tortellini and Veggies - healthy, easy Mediterranean-style dinner. Sliced boneless, skinless chicken thighs are cooked with sun-dried tomatoes in olive oil. Then, cooked chicken is combined with asparagus, cherry tomatoes, tortellini, and basil pesto!

    How to make chicken tortellini with veggies:

    1) Add 1 pound of sliced skinless and boneless chicken thighs (seasoned with salt), 2 tablespoons olive oil, and ¼ cup of sun-dried tomatoes to a large skillet.

    2) Cook on medium heat for 5-10 minutes, until the chicken is completely cooked through.

    3) Remove the cooked chicken and sun-dried tomatoes from the skillet, leaving the oil in.

    4) Add 1 pound of asparagus (ends trimmed), seasoned with salt, ¼ cup of sun-dried tomatoes to the same skillet.

    5) Cook on medium heat for 5-10 minutes until the asparagus is cooked through.

    6) Cook 1 cup tortellini according to the package instructions, drain.

    7) In the same skillet combine cooked chicken, cooked asparagus, cooked tortellini, and halved cherry tomatoes.

    8) Mix everything with ¼ cup of basil pesto on low-medium heat until the chicken is reheated, 1 or 2 minutes.

    Pesto Chicken Tortellini and Veggies

    Chicken Tortellini smothered with basil pesto and served with lots of veggies. Mediterranean style dinner packed with colorful vegetables: red and yellow grape tomatoes, asparagus, and sun-dried tomatoes.

    Prep Time 20 minutes mins
    Cook Time 20 minutes mins
    Total Time 40 minutes mins
    Course Main Course
    Cuisine Mediterranean
    Servings 4 servings
    Calories per serving 517 kcal
    Author: Julia

    Ingredients

    • 2 tablespoons olive oil
    • 1 lb chicken thighs boneless and skinless, sliced into strips
    • salt
    • ½ cup sun-dried tomatoes drained of oil, chopped
    • 1 lb asparagus ends trimmed, cut in half
    • ¼ cup basil pesto or use more
    • 1 cup cherry tomatoes yellow and red, halved
    • 1 cup tortellini uncooked

    Instructions 

    • In a large skillet heat 2 tablespoons olive oil on medium heat.  
    • Add sliced chicken thighs (seasoned with salt), ¼ cup of chopped sun-dried tomatoes and cook everything on medium heat for 5-10 minutes, turning chicken slices over a couple of times, until the chicken is completely cooked through.
    • Remove the chicken and the sun-dried from the skillet, leaving the oil in.
    • Add asparagus (ends trimmed), seasoned generously with salt, and ¼ cup of sun-dried tomatoes to the same skillet.  
    • Cook on medium heat for 5-10 minutes until the asparagus is cooked through. Remove the asparagus to a serving plate.
    • Cook tortellini according to the package instructions, drain.
    • Add cooked chicken back to the skillet.   Add basil pesto.  Stir to coat and cook on low-medium heat until the chicken is reheated, 1 or 2 minutes. Remove from heat. 
    • Add cooked tortellini and halved cherry tomatoes to the skillet with the chicken.  Stir to combine.  Add more pesto if desired.
    • Season with more salt if needed.  
    • Add chicken, cherry tomatoes and tortellini to the serving plate with asparagus.
